js正則表達(dá)式實(shí)現(xiàn)數(shù)字每隔四位用空格分隔代碼
數(shù)字每隔四位用空格分隔代碼實(shí)例:
分享一段代碼實(shí)例,它實(shí)現(xiàn)了數(shù)字每隔四位就用空格分隔。
這樣的效果在填寫銀行卡的時(shí)候十分常見,這也是非常人性化的舉措。
代碼實(shí)例如下:
<!doctype html> <html> <head> <meta charset="utf-8"> <title>腳本之家</title> <script src="http://libs.baidu.com/jquery/1.9.0/jquery.js"></script> <script> $(document).ready(function () { $('#ant').on('keyup mouseout input', function () { var $this = $(this); var v = $this.val(); /\S{5}/.test(v) && $this.val(v.replace(/\s/g, '').replace(/(.{4})/g, "$1 ")); }); }) </script> </head> <body> <input type="text" id="ant" /> </body> </html>
上面的代碼實(shí)現(xiàn)了我們的要求,更多內(nèi)容可以參閱相關(guān)閱讀。
相關(guān)閱讀:
(1).on()可以參閱jquery on()綁定事件處理函數(shù)詳解一章節(jié)。
(2).keyup事件可以參閱jQuery keyup事件一章節(jié)。
(3).val()方法可以參閱jQuery val()方法一章節(jié)。
(4).test()方法可以參閱正則表達(dá)式test()函數(shù)一章節(jié)。
(5).replace()可以參閱正則表達(dá)式replace()函數(shù)一章節(jié)。
(6).$1可以參閱正則表達(dá)式replace()函數(shù)一章節(jié)。
(7).子表達(dá)式可以參閱正則表達(dá)式分組一章節(jié)。
相關(guān)文章
正則表達(dá)式處理圖片地址、img標(biāo)簽的方法
這篇文章主要介紹了正則表達(dá)式處理圖片地址、img標(biāo)簽的方法,非常不錯(cuò),具有參考借鑒價(jià)值,需要的朋友可以參考下2017-05-05一個(gè)容易犯錯(cuò)的js手機(jī)號(hào)碼驗(yàn)證正則表達(dá)式(推薦)
這篇文章主要介紹了 一個(gè)容易犯錯(cuò)的js手機(jī)號(hào)碼驗(yàn)證正則表達(dá)式(推薦),需要的朋友可以參考下2017-03-03關(guān)于內(nèi)容的分離,正則抽出圖片(一定要加精哦)
我們?cè)诩觾?nèi)容時(shí),無論你怎么樣排版都好,我們都是無法將里面的圖片或是別的什么東西抽出來的.2009-01-01